Visualizzazione dei risultati da 1 a 8 su 8
  1. #1

    Mettere una parte di una pagina in una scrollbar ma senza iframe

    Mi spiego meglio: mi interesserebbe avere una tabella con una cella di dimensioni definite, e l'eventuale codice html interno non deve in alcun modo ridimensionare la cella (come accade normalmente), ma fare in modo che si possa scorrere il testo con una scrollbar.

    In pratica la cosa è fattibilissima se nella cella ci metto un iframe che punta ad una pagina in cui c'è il codice html in una nuova pagina, ma mi sembra una forzatura un po' "sporca", sopratutto se poi voglio gestire i link interni alla pagina...

    C'è un modo alternativo all'utilizzo degli iframe?

  2. #2

    Re: Mettere una parte di una pagina in una scrollbar ma senza iframe

    Originariamente inviato da cicciox80
    Mi spiego meglio: mi interesserebbe avere una tabella con una cella di dimensioni definite, e l'eventuale codice html interno non deve in alcun modo ridimensionare la cella (come accade normalmente), ma fare in modo che si possa scorrere il testo con una scrollbar.

    In pratica la cosa è fattibilissima se nella cella ci metto un iframe che punta ad una pagina in cui c'è il codice html in una nuova pagina, ma mi sembra una forzatura un po' "sporca", sopratutto se poi voglio gestire i link interni alla pagina...

    C'è un modo alternativo all'utilizzo degli iframe?
    up...

  3. #3
    prova applicando lo stile:

    overflow:scroll

    all'elemento che ti interessa...


  4. #4

  5. #5
    Originariamente inviato da sonik_the_sonik
    prova applicando lo stile:

    overflow:scroll

    all'elemento che ti interessa...

    ho provato a farlo in una cella di una tabella, ma nulla!

    questo è l'esempio:

    codice:
    <html>
    <body>
    <table border="1" id="table1" width="410">
        <tr>
            <td height="50" width="100"></td>
    
    
            <td style="overflow:scroll"  height="100" valign="top" width="193">
                sopra la panca la capra campa, sopra la panca la capra campa, sopra la 
                panca la capra campa, sopra la panca la capra campa, sopra la panca la 
                capra campa, sopra la panca la capra campa, sopra la panca la capra 
                campa, sopra la panca la capra campa, </td>
    
    
            <td height="100" width="97"></td>
        </tr>
    </table>
    </body>
    </html>

  6. #6
    Originariamente inviato da sonik_the_sonik
    prova applicando lo stile:

    overflow:scroll

    all'elemento che ti interessa...

    sììììì

    ora passo la pagina in analisi...spero che non ci siano iframe

  7. #7
    RISOLTO!!!

    ho messo "overflow:scroll" in un div anzichè un TD,
    anzi ho messo overflow:auto che è meglio

    ecco qua:

    codice:
    <html>
    <body>
    <table border="1" id="table1" width="410">
    	<tr>
    		<td height="50" width="100"></td>
    		<td height="100" valign="top" width="193">
    		<div style="OVERFLOW: auto; HEIGHT: 100px">
    		sopra la panca la capra campa, sopra la panca la capra campa, sopra la 
    		panca la capra campa, sopra la panca la capra campa, sopra la panca la 
    		capra campa, sopra la panca la capra campa, sopra la panca la capra 
    		campa, sopra la panca la capra campa, 
    		</div>
    		</td>
    		<td height="100" width="97"></td>
    	</tr>
    </table>
    </body>
    </html>
    thanks a sonik e a t1t

  8. #8
    De nada


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.